> > arch/mips/boot/dts/brcm/bcm96358nb4ser.dts does not exist, so
> > we cannot build bcm96358nb4ser.dtb .

This appears to be due to the file being renamed in commit 695835511f96
("MIPS: BMIPS: rename bcm96358nb4ser to bcm6358-neufbox4-sercom").
Please can you update the commit message when you resend to mention the
cause of the problem.

You could also add the following if you like while you're at it:

Fixes: 695835511f96 ("MIPS: BMIPS: rename bcm96358nb4ser to bcm6358-neufbox4-sercom")
Cc: <stable@vger.kernel.org> # 4.9+
